Attorney General written question – answered on 15th November 2017.
To ask Her Majesty's Government what guidelines they have issued to Crown Prosecutors on the prosecution of persons for operating unregistered schools.
The Crown Prosecution Service has issued legal guidance for Crown Prosecutors on prosecuting criminal offences relating to unregistered schools under sections 96 and 97 of the Education and Skills Act 2008. CPS guidance is publicly available via the CPS website and can be accessed at: www.cps.gov.uk/legal/d_to_g/education/
